TBH, I thought the Swamcaller would be closer to the Earthcaller at this point with the 2h changes. I still carry one though since for 500p it’s hard not to and makes for that one-click swap.

I think the EC and claw are a bit closer than my test showed (one SW parse was 69 which is far below the rest). Taking that out the average of the BoF/SW would jump to 83 vs 88 with the BoF/claw. The SW might even be closer on higher level mobs where the hit low/high spread is greater.

The Tunare braid is another underrated weapon. 50/tick from that dot is just over 8dps when active. Very similar to the SK epic (minus the tap aspect). If it lands on the fight, that dot is really pumping up your numbers despite not showing up on the public parse.

There are a lot of solid raid upgrades for a ranger that aren’t a ton of points. A Meljeldin or Shovel would be one-stop shopping and are the cheapest way to check that BiS ratio goal. A primal 2h is cheap and synergizes well with them. Even with worn haste and shiss that one-two swap is the best way to really good raid numbers outside a BFG.

I did a lot more Geonid killing in WL trying to keep the stats as close as possible for comparison sake. No buffs like DS or Call of Fire which would mess with the parse. No proccing Avatar either since the upkeep is annoying. Lastly, when/if the geo ran I would turn to face it. Most the ones I fought were still blue but I wasn’t only killing blues. I did not fight shams intentionally but seems one snuck in below which I labeled. Ideally I would have done more than 5-10 fights per set, tried with and without Avatar, or even found a target that isn't a low/mid 40's npc since I do not think this will scale to raid mobs. That said...it's a pretty controlled test. Sorry again about the formatting.

Baton of Flame/Claw of Lightning 100%, no DS, no Avatar, no Call of Fire etc
Greater Wolf Form, SoN, CoTP, one AoB, Storm Strength
237 STR, 1352 Attack Power, 91% Haste (Dragon gloves + Sky cloak)

Total=Dmg=Time=DPS=Dmg to PC
7778=84=92=2159
7887=82=96=1251
7358=89=84=2280
7491=91=82=1700
7692=85=90=1919
7933=93=85=2535
7892=89=88=2886
7091=78=90=1364
7548=83=90=1837

Total Damage 75763
Total Time 852
Average DPS 88
Total Damage Taken 19451
